pedimental

/ˌpɛdɪˈmɛntəl/ adjective · British & US
Valid in UKValid in US
Share WhatsApp

What does pedimental mean?

adjective

Relating to or resembling a pediment, especially in architecture; having a pediment-like quality.

Example

"The pedimental design of the building's facade added a touch of elegance to the structure."
